Mesa Community College is located in Mesa, AZ.

During the most recent reporting year, 477 liberal arts general studies degrees were granted at Mesa Community College.

Online Class Availability at Mesa Community College

Many students take online classes at Mesa Community College. Of 17,077 students, 4,620 (27%) were enrolled entirely in distance education and 5,003 (29%) took at least some classes online.

Earnings for Liberal Arts General Studies Graduates from Mesa Community College

Students who complete Mesa Community College’s Liberal Arts General Studies program report the following median earnings (per the U.S. Department of Education’s College Scorecard):

Median earnings by years after graduation for Liberal Arts General Studies at Mesa Community College
Years After Graduation Median Earnings
1 year $32,707
2 years $33,565
3 years $37,094
4 years $43,433
5 years $49,609

How do these earnings stack up against the rest of the school? At the four-year mark, Liberal Arts General Studies graduates from Mesa Community College take home a median $43,433, compared with $46,504 for all Mesa Community College graduates — about 7% lower than the school-wide median.

Median Debt at Graduation

Median student loan debt for Liberal Arts General Studies graduates from Mesa Community College is $10,500.

Student Demographics & Diversity

The following sections describe the diversity of Liberal Arts General Studies graduates at Mesa Community College, broken down by degree level.

Program-wide, Liberal Arts General Studies graduates at Mesa Community College are 61% women (292) and 39% men (185).

Liberal Arts General Studies Associate’s Program at Mesa Community College

Of the 477 associate’s liberal arts general studies graduates at Mesa Community College, 61% were women (292) and 39% were men (185).

Mesa Community College gender breakdown of Liberal Arts General Studies Associate's degree recipients

The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Liberal Arts General Studies associate’s degree recipients at Mesa Community College.

Race / Ethnicity Number of Graduates
White 221
Hispanic / Latino 132
Black / African American 29
Asian 18
American Indian / Alaska Native 22
Two or More Races 40
International (Nonresident) 4
Unknown 11
Racial-ethnic diversity of Liberal Arts General Studies majors at Mesa Community College

Racial-ethnic minorities make up 51% of Liberal Arts General Studies associate’s degree recipients at Mesa Community College, higher than the national average of 49%.*

*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
